Roof leaks can lead to serious water damage if not addressed promptly. In Dimondale, Michigan, our team of experts understands the unique challenges that come with roof leaks caused by seasonal weather changes, aging roofing materials, or unforeseen storms. When your roof is compromised, water can seep into your home, damaging ceilings, walls, and even your belongings. Recognizing the signs early and acting swiftly can save you thousands in repair costs and prevent mold growth.

Common causes of roof leaks include damaged or missing shingles, clogged gutters, and poor attic ventilation. Severe weather events such as heavy rain, snow, or hail can exacerbate existing vulnerabilities in your roof structure. Over time, roofing materials degrade due to exposure to the elements, and small cracks or gaps can develop, allowing water to penetrate. Additionally, improper installation or lack of maintenance can contribute to ongoing leakage issues, emphasizing the importance of professional inspection and timely repairs.

Frequently Asked Questions

What are the signs of a roof leak?

Visible water stains on ceilings or walls, peeling paint, mold growth, and increased energy bills can all indicate a roof leak. Sometimes, you may notice water dripping inside after heavy rain. Early detection helps prevent extensive damage and costly repairs.

How quickly should I call for repair after noticing a leak?

Will my insurance cover roof leak repairs?

Coverage depends on your policy and the cause of the leak. Typically, damage from storms or sudden events are covered, while neglect or lack of maintenance may not. We recommend consulting with your insurance provider and working with our team for detailed documentation and assistance.

How long does roof leak repair take?

The duration depends on the extent of the damage. Minor repairs can be completed within a day, while extensive restoration may take several days. We provide clear timelines during the assessment and keep you informed throughout the process.

Can I prevent roof leaks in the future?

Regular inspections, timely maintenance, and prompt repairs are essential. Cleaning gutters, ensuring proper attic ventilation, and replacing damaged shingles can extend your roofโ€™s lifespan and reduce leak risks. Our experts can help develop a maintenance plan tailored to your home.
